Image Credits: Liz hallPerhaps that you have seen a massive tent or tarp covering a house or other structure and wondered, what it was What you saw is evidence of termite tenting or fumigation, which, despite continued concerns, has been proven not to pose a risk to humans or pets as long as the process is allowed to run its course undisturbed.

But the average cost for Termie Tenting can be from $1,200 to $2,500 for a 1,250-square foot home. And $2,200 $3,800 for a 2,500-square foot housePossible drawbacksEnvironmentalists deplore the use of fumigation for a pest control plan against termite infestations. However, the process continues to be employed and some countries even require it be done in front of a house can be marketed.

Following this treatment, don't forget to air the structure before using it again.CostChemical extermination is generally priced by the linear foot. A home that is around 150-linear feet, or 1,250-square ft, will cost approximately $1,350 to $2,500 for a chemical extermination service. A 2,500-square foot home with 200 linear feet will be about $1,700-$3,200.
